Fangrui Song 6d2d3bd0a6 [ELF] Default to -z start-stop-gc with a glibc "__libc_" special case
Change the default to facilitate GC for metadata section usage, so that they
don't need SHF_LINK_ORDER or SHF_GROUP just to drop the unhelpful rule (if they
want to be unconditionally retained, use SHF_GNU_RETAIN
(`__attribute__((retain))`) or linker script `KEEP`).

The dropped SHF_GROUP special case makes the behavior of -z start-stop-gc and -z
nostart-stop-gc closer to GNU ld>=2.37 (https://sourceware.org/PR27451).

However, we default to -z start-stop-gc (which actually matches more closely to
GNU ld before 2015-10 https://sourceware.org/PR19167), which is different from
modern GNU ld (which has the unhelpful rule to work around glibc). As a
compensation, we special case `__libc_` sections as a workaround for glibc<2.34
(https://sourceware.org/PR27492).

Since -z start-stop-gc as the default actually matches the traditional GNU ld
behavior, there isn't much to be aware of. There was a systemd usage which has
been fixed by https://github.com/systemd/systemd/pull/19144

## Check that group members are retained or discarded as a unit.
# REQUIRES: x86
# RUN: llvm-mc -filetype=obj -triple=x86_64-unknown-linux %s -o %t.o
# RUN: ld.lld %t.o --gc-sections -o %t
# RUN: llvm-readelf -s %t | FileCheck %s
# RUN: echo ".global __start___data; __start___data:" > %t2.s
# RUN: llvm-mc -filetype=obj -triple=x86_64-unknown-linux %t2.s -o %t2.o
# RUN: ld.lld -shared %t2.o --soname=t2 -o %t2.so
# RUN: ld.lld %t.o --gc-sections -o %t2 %t2.so
# RUN: llvm-readelf -s %t2 | FileCheck %s
## The referenced __data is retained.
# CHECK: [[#%x,ADDR:]] {{.*}} __start___data
# CHECK: [[#ADDR + 8]] {{.*}} __stop___data
## __libc_atexit is retained even if there is no reference, as a workaround for
## glibc<2.34 (BZ #27492).
# CHECK: [[#%x,ADDR:]] {{.*}} __start___libc_atexit
# CHECK: [[#ADDR + 8]] {{.*}} __stop___libc_atexit
# CHECK: _start
# CHECK: f
# CHECK-NOT: g
## If -z nostart-stop-gc, sections whose names are C identifiers are retained by
## __start_/__stop_ references.
# RUN: ld.lld %t.o %t2.so --gc-sections -z nostart-stop-gc -o %t3
# RUN: llvm-readelf -s %t3 | FileCheck %s --check-prefix=NOGC
# NOGC: [[#%x,ADDR:]] {{.*}} __start___data
# NOGC: [[#ADDR + 16]] {{.*}} __stop___data
.weak __start___data
.weak __stop___data
.weak __start___libc_atexit
.weak __stop___libc_atexit
.section .text,"ax",@progbits
.global _start
_start:
.quad __start___data - .
.quad __stop___data - .
.quad __start___libc_atexit - .
.quad __stop___libc_atexit - .
call f
.section __data,"axG",@progbits,f
.quad 0
.section .text.f,"axG",@progbits,f
.global f
f:
nop
.section __data,"axG",@progbits,g
.quad 0
.section .text.g,"axG",@progbits,g
.global g
g:
nop
.section __libc_atexit,"a",@progbits
.quad 0
